They aren’t hard to get. All you have to do is send out press releases on a regular basis. Make it about home inspections, interesting ,and timely, not about you. There are plenty of sights on the internet about how to write a short press release (that’s the easy part). Send them to everyone in the media. Finding out their names and addresses takes a little internet search work (that’s the harder part). Then wait… sometimes months (that’s the hardest part).

If you are a member of your local Chamber of Comerce, They will give you a list of business media contacs in your area. Heck, they may even help you secure a spot if you tout your membership.


Iv'e got an article I wrote comming out in the next issue of Smith Mountain Lake Living real estate section. The spot was a direct result of Chamber help.
